Output e50f130973ad65ef4f563c5c82cb69f709ce46d66ecaa919addfb1c93b15943e:12

value
208564
script pubkey
OP_HASH160 OP_PUSHBYTES_20 90ad27ed73d2ae4ae6cd2e1d268c825144038174 OP_EQUAL
address
3EszfFjXvP9Vsz3b56T3kPGS951wLtt7ap
transaction
e50f130973ad65ef4f563c5c82cb69f709ce46d66ecaa919addfb1c93b15943e
spent
true